===== Solr ===== | ===== Solr ===== |
| |
VuFind's main Solr-based search has customizable highlighting features controlled by the highlighting setting in [[:searches.ini]]. The related snippets setting and [Snippets_Captions] section may be used to control the display of highlighted text snippets when matches are found outside of the fields normally displayed by default as part of a search result. | VuFind's main Solr-based search has customizable highlighting features controlled by the highlighting setting in [[configuration:files:searches.ini]]. ===== Summon ===== | ===== Summon ===== |
| |
Highlighting in the Summon module is slightly less flexible than Solr highlighting, but it works very similarly, using the highlighting and snippets settings found in [[:summon.ini|Summon.ini]]. | Highlighting in the Summon module is slightly less flexible than Solr highlighting, but it works very similarly, using the highlighting and snippets settings found in [[configuration:files:summon.ini|Summon.ini]]. |

Since WorldCat does not have a native highlighting feature, VuFind achieves highlighting of WorldCat results through the |highlight modifier in the WorldCat/list-list.tpl Smarty template -- there are no .ini settings involved. To change highlighting functionality, you can override the template and/or change the definition of the highlight CSS class. | |
